My almost 10 year old daughter wants to hunt deer like her brothers. She'll be 10 in a month and only option at that point is a black powder season here in MN. I frankly know nothing about black powder guns but purchased a 50 cal modern muzzleloader...traditions xt. I've not yet looked into anything but I assume there are different charges and a multitude of bullets to choose from. My concern is kick. Realistically if she shooting anything it'll be like 30 yards. Any info on setup would be appreciated!

When my son was 10 he shot his first deer at 80 yards with 100 grains of 50/50 triple seven pellets and a TC Encore sabot. He was very small and had zero problems with kick. Generally the barrels are heavy on muzzle loaders helping reduce the recoil.

Blackhorn and Barnes 250grain expander. Skip the powerbelts. No more than 80 grains by volume BH209. Start her off at 50-60 grains to get her comfortable.
